How Stuffy McInnis's Gross Production Average (GPA) Compares to Similar Players
Stuffy McInnis posted a career Gross Production Average (GPA) of .249, near the league average of .247 — a profile that tracked closely with league norms. His best Gross Production Average (GPA) season came in 1925, posting .318, well above the league average of .264 that year. The lowest point came in 1909 at .205, near the league average of .216 that year. Production slipped through the final seasons. The figure moved from .318 in 1925 to .242 in 1926. The decline marked the closing chapter of the career. One of the more consistent Gross Production Average (GPA) producers of his era, the career line shows near-average output with little season-to-season variance across 19 seasons.
